Use when you're about to build an outreach sequence (Lemlist, Instantly, HeyReach, …). The cadence shape is the client's call, not an assumption — so always prompt the user with a few example plays and confirm before building.
Rule: confirm the cadence before building
Never assume the channel
Default to what the data + client supports: no email on the leads → LinkedIn-only; candidate acquisition → LinkedIn + personal email (never work email).
Prompt the user with 2–4 example plays
Let them pick or tweak steps, delays, branching.
Build it cold
No sender, no draft, no leads, not started. Sending (start_campaign) is separately
approval-gated.
Example plays
A — LinkedIn-only: connect → messages (no email)
D0 linkedinVisit → D1 linkedinInvite (no note)
└ IF linkedinInviteAccepted within 3d → linkedinSend ×3 (D0, +2, +3)B — LinkedIn-first + email fallback (multichannel)
D0 linkedinVisit → D1 linkedinInvite (no note)
└ accepted within 3d → linkedinSend ×3 (if email on file: LinkedIn first, email only if no reply)
└ fallback (not accepted in ~5d) → email-only sequence (fires only when a lead has an email)Building a sequence is free; starting it spends nothing on the sequencer (all sequencers
are free on Hyreflow, and run on your own connected account) but is still approval-gated because it
sends real messages. Confirm the sender, the draft, and the lead list before start_campaign.
Sequencers
All sequencers are free on Hyreflow's credit model: Instantly, Lemlist, HeyReach, Smartlead, SendKit, SourceWhale. Each one runs on your own account, so connect it on the Integrations page before the first send — Instantly, Lemlist, HeyReach, Smartlead and SendKit take an API key there; SourceWhale isn't self-serve yet, so contact Hyreflow to get it enabled. Pick the one you already run — SendKit is the pick when you want to check a mailbox's warmup and deliverability before it sends. See Providers.
